What the 2015 WARN Record Shows

In 2015, employers filed 138 WARN Act notices in this dataset, reporting 21,806 affected workers across 121 employers and 14 sectors.

Sep was the heaviest month, with 4,484 workers (21% of the 2015 total). Against 2014, workers affected rose 22%. That makes 2015 the 9th-largest of the 19 years on record. BAE Systems alone accounts for 7% of the year's affected workers. Other Services led sector totals at 52% of 2015 workers, ahead of Manufacturing. VA led the geography at 10,139 workers (46% of 2015), ahead of IN, so one state shapes the annual map. That flips the prior-year geographic lead: 2014 was headed by WA, while 2015 is headed by VA. The single largest 2015 filing was BAE Systems in Norfolk, VA at 1,512 workers (7% of the year), noticed 2015-09-21 with an effective date of 2015-11-20.

Closest years by workers affected: 2012 (20,933 workers, 4% lower); 2017 (20,701 workers, 5% lower); 2009 (19,166 workers, 12% lower); 2013 (18,692 workers, 14% lower).

Coverage limits, filing-year rules, and entitlements

WARN notices cover qualifying events, not every workforce reduction: federal coverage depends on the employer, worksite, event size, workforce share, timing, and exceptions, while state rules can differ. At an average of 158 workers per notice, 2015 filings tracked with mid-scale restructuring and consolidation within multi-site operators. A notice is counted in the year it was FILED, not the year separations take effect, so a December filing whose layoffs land in January still belongs here. A listed worker or filing does not by itself establish an individual entitlement; our guide explains the factors to check.

Does the WARN Act data capture all layoffs in 2015?

No. WARN notices cover qualifying events, not every workforce reduction. Federal coverage depends on the employer, worksite, event size, workforce share, timing, and exceptions; state rules can differ. Gradual attrition and voluntary separation programs are also not included, so actual job losses can be higher than the WARN record alone suggests.
